Analysis
In 2022, net official flows from un agencies, unfpa (current us$), gaps filled in Least developed countries stood at 166.80 million current US$. That is the highest value across all 46 years on record.
The figure is up 16.2% on the previous year and up 21.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, net official flows from un agencies, unfpa (current us$), gaps filled in Least developed countries peaked at 166.80 million current US$ in 2022 and was at its lowest, 8.70 million current US$, in 1977.
Least developed countries ranks 10th of 47 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Net official flows from UN agencies, UNFPA (current US$) with 350 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
Computed from
- Net official flows from UN agencies, UNFPA Development Assistance Committee,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
